German Honour Killing


Further to my post about forced marriage and honour killings the Spiegel reports today the horrific story of the 'execution' of 24 year old Emine See, witnessed by her 5 year old daughter on the way to nursery in Munich. After ambushing and shooting Emine, the Turkish uncle of her ex-husband shot the the little girl in the chest before turning the gun on himself. Emine died at the scene, the uncle died later in hospital and the little girl was admitted to hospital and is expected to survive.

Gülsen Celebi, a lawyer who represents Muslim women said it isn't unusual in Muslim culture for a woman who separates from her husband to be forced into marrying into the husband's family so there is no shame brought to the family. She believes it is possible this tragic murder was the result of Emine rejecting the uncle's advances rather than retaliation for divorcing her ex-husband. Either way such behaviour is completely intolerable and totally unacceptable anywhere, but in particular in any modern European country.
